CNEW.AX was created on 2018-11-08 by VanEck. The fund's investment portfolio concentrates primarily on total market equity. CNEW.AX gives investors a portfolio of the most fundamentally sound companies in China having the best growth prospects in sectors making up the New Economy, namely technology, health care, consumer staples and consumer discretionary. CNEW.AX aims to provide investment returns, before fees and other costs, which track the performance of the Index.

MMKT.AX was created on 2023-11-22 by BetaShares. The fund's investment portfolio concentrates primarily on investment grade fixed income. MMKT.AX aims to generate a yield (before fees and expenses) that exceeds the Bloomberg AusBond Bank Bill Index (Benchmark), from a portfolio of Australian dollar cash and short-term money market securities issued by investment grade entities
